I didn’t sleep that night.

The words from the unknown number kept replaying in my head.

ā€œThey’ll pay for everything.ā€

At first, I thought it was a prank. Maybe one of my friends trying to comfort me after the humiliation of being thrown out by my husband, Ethan, and his smug young mistress, Chloe.

But deep down, something felt… different.

Three days later, Ethan called.

For the first time in weeks, he sounded nervous.

ā€œDid you tell my mother what happened?ā€ he snapped.

ā€œNo,ā€ I answered coldly. ā€œWhy?ā€

He hesitated. ā€œShe showed up here.ā€

I nearly laughed. My mother-in-law, Vivian, hated drama and rarely visited anyone. If she had shown up unannounced, something serious was happening.

ā€œWhat did she say?ā€ I asked.

Silence.

Then he muttered, ā€œShe wants us out of the house.ā€

My heart stopped.

ā€œWhat?ā€

ā€œThat houseā€¦ā€ he exhaled sharply, ā€œwas never fully mine.ā€

I remembered the day we bought it. Ethan had handled all the paperwork while I was recovering from surgery. I trusted him completely back then.

Vivian arrived at my apartment that evening.

Elegant as always, dressed in cream-colored silk, she looked around my tiny rented place and her eyes softened.

ā€œYou shouldn’t be here,ā€ she said quietly.

I folded my arms. ā€œYour son made that clear.ā€

ā€œNo,ā€ she replied firmly. ā€œMy son made a mistake.ā€

Then she placed a folder on my table.

Inside were copies of legal documents.

The house had been purchased through a family trust controlled by Vivian. She had added one condition years ago: if Ethan committed adultery during the marriage, ownership rights would be revoked immediately.

I stared at her in shock.

ā€œYou knew he’d cheat?ā€

Her expression darkened. ā€œI knew what kind of man I raised.ā€

Apparently, one of the neighbors had recognized Chloe and sent photos to Vivian weeks before I was kicked out. The moment she confirmed the affair, she activated the clause.

ā€œThat textā€¦ā€ I whispered. ā€œWas it from you?ā€

Vivian gave a small smile. ā€œI wanted you to know someone was on your side.ā€

A week later, Ethan and Chloe were forced to move out.

But karma wasn’t finished.

Chloe discovered Ethan was drowning in debt. Ethan discovered Chloe had only stayed because she thought he owned the house.

Their relationship exploded publicly online within days.

Meanwhile, Vivian helped me hire a lawyer.

Not only did I receive my share of our savings, but Ethan was ordered to return every piece of jewelry and property he had withheld—including my mother’s heirloom ring.

The day he handed it back, he couldn’t even look me in the eyes.

ā€œI made a mistake,ā€ he whispered.

I slid the ring onto my finger and smiled calmly.

ā€œNo,ā€ I said. ā€œYou made a choice.ā€

Then I walked away for good.
